Cheesy Tuna Pasta Bake Recipe

Ingredients
- 250g Pasta
- 400g tin of Tuna, drained
- 250g of Bolognaise sauce
- 1 red onion, diced
- 2 cloves of Garlic, finely chopped
- Pinch of dried Chili flakes
- Large handful of Peas
- 100g Haloumi cheese, diced
- 150g Cheddar cheese, grated

How to make Cheesy Tuna Pasta Bake
I'm ill. I have little in the cupboards. Time for a Ready Steady Cook meal. With some delving I found I had all of these ingredients to hand.
- Heat your oven to Gas Mark 4
- Put the pasta on to cook for a few minutes, they don't need to be fully cooked
- Gently fry off the onion and garlic, and added the chili flakes
- Then add the tuna, breaking up any larger pieces, followed by the peas and the haloumi
- Add the bolognaise sauce then the pasta and give it a good stir
- Tip the mix into a baking dish, cover with the cheddar
- Bake for about 20 minutes or until the cheese is all bubbly and some of the exposed pasta is crunchy
